The CIA made a big effort to get the Warren Commission report out to the world.

On September 22, 1964, a CIA Bulletin titled “Propaganda Notes” detailed that the State Department was going to be sending copies of the soon-to-be-released Warren Commission Report to “American Diplomatic Posts” for “selective presentation to ‘editors, jurists, Government officials, and other opinion leaders.’”

The Propaganda Notes Bulletin also states that CIA Headquarters was going to send “copies of this Government Printing Office edition” to CIA “field stations,” where “covert assets should explain the tragedy wherever it is genuinely misunderstood and counter all efforts to misconstrue it . . . Divisions should make bulk purchases for filed use through regular channels.”

And by January 1967, a little more than two years after the Propaganda Notes Bulletin, the CIA was so concerned about the fact that people did not believe the Warren Commission Report that it issued a 13-page dispatch and the subject was “Countering Criticism of the Warren Report.”

The dispatch states that “speculation about the responsibility” for President Kennedy’s assassination had been “stemmed by the Warren Commission report, which appeared at the end of September 1964.”

And the dispatch continued, “Various writers have now had time to scan the Commission’s published report and documents . . . There has been a new wave of books and articles criticizing the Commission’s findings . . . Conspiracy theories have frequently thrown suspicion on our organization.”

Under “Action,” the dispatch instructs CIA officers to “discuss the publicity problem with liaison and friendly elite contacts, especially politicians and editors” and tell these “friendly” contacts that “the charges of the critics are without serious foundation.” The dispatch also instructs the agents to “urge” their contacts to “use their influence” to assist in countering criticism of the Warren Report.

CIA officers were told to use “propaganda assets to answer and refute the attacks of the critics. Book reviews and feature articles are particularly appropriate for this purpose.”
